Three Critical Mistakes to Avoid When Claiming a Phone Bill Bonus
Even the best offer can turn sour if you make a simple error. Based on our testing and analysis of terms and conditions, here are three things you should never do when claiming a bonus through your phone bill.
- Never ignore the game contribution percentages. Most wagering requirements specify that only certain slots contribute 100% to the playthrough. Table games and live dealer titles often contribute far less, sometimes as low as 10%. If you play blackjack with a bonus active, you’re essentially throwing your money away. Always check the eligible games list in the T&Cs before you spin.
- Never accept a bonus without checking the max bet limit. Many operators impose a £2 or £5 maximum bet while wagering is active. If you accidentally place a £10 spin, the casino can void your bonus and confiscate any winnings. This is a common trap for players who are used to higher stakes. Set a reminder on your phone or simply avoid playing with bonus funds if you prefer larger bets.
- Never let the bonus expire. Free spins and deposit matches often have a 48-hour or 7-day window to claim and use. If you deposit on a Friday but do not activate the spins until Sunday, you might find them already expired. Set a calendar alert the moment you deposit. A missed deadline means lost value, and that’s a cardinal sin for a strategy-focused player.
These three rules are non-negotiable. Ignoring them is the fastest way to turn a positive expected value scenario into a loss.

>Can I use phone bill deposits at all UKGC licensed casinos?
Not all operators accept phone bill deposits. The method is more common at mobile-focused brands like MrQ and Sky Vegas. Always check the banking page before signing up. If you don’t see the option, consider using a debit card or e-wallet instead.
>Are there any fees for depositing via phone bill?
Most operators don’t charge a fee for phone bill deposits. However, your mobile network provider may apply a small charge or limit the amount you can deposit per day. Check with your provider before making a large deposit.

>What happens if I exceed my phone bill deposit limit?
Your mobile network provider sets a daily or weekly cap on phone bill transactions. If you hit that limit, the deposit will be declined. You can usually use an alternative method like a debit card to complete the transaction.
